Movie Overview: Bixler High Private Eye
| Movie | Bixler High Private Eye |
| Release Year | 2019 |
| Director | Leslie Kolins Small |
| Genre | Adventure / Family / TV Movie / Mystery |
| Runtime | 66 minutes (1h 6m) |
| Language | EN |

What Happens at the End of Bixler High Private Eye?
Teenage detective Xander DeWitt is the new kid at Bixler Valley High, and he's there to unravel the biggest mystery of his life- the truth about his missing father. But in order to crack this case, Xander must learn to work with a partner- fearless investigative reporter Kenzie Messina.
